The Institute for Intergovernmental

Tallahassee, Florida  ·  EIN 591860916  ·  Private foundation

The Institute for Intergovernmental is a private foundation based in Tallahassee, Florida. Its most recent IRS Form 990-PF reports $5.5M in grants paid and $5.7M in total assets. Grant history

The largest grants Bespoke Grants has on record for The Institute for Intergovernmental, by amount:

RecipientLocationGrantYear
Integrated Justice Information Ststems Institute Inc
PROGRAM MANAGEMENT, TECHNOLOGY MAINTENANCE, AND OPERATIONAL SUPPORT FOR A PRESCRIPTION DRUG MONITORING HUB.
Ashburn, VA$2.7M2024
Integrated Justice Information System Institute Inc
PROGRAM MANAGEMENT, TECHNOLOGY MAINTENANCE, AND OPERATIONAL SUPPORT FOR A PRESCRIPTION DRUG MONITORING HUB.
Ashburn, VA$2.4M2022
Integrated Justice Information Systems Institute Inc
PROGRAM MANAGEMENT, TECHNOLOGY MAINTENANCE, AND OPERATIONAL SUPPORT FOR A PRESCRIPTION DRUG MONITORING HUB.
Ashburn, VA$2.3M2023
Advocates for Human Potential
PREPARE THE GUIDELINES FOR MANAGING SUBSTANCE WITHDRAWAL IN JAILS FOR BJA
Sudbury, MA$781K2023
Reno County Health Department
PREVENTING AND REDUCING OVERDOSE DEATHS ASSOCIATED WITH OPIOIDS
Hutchinson, KS$549K2022
Ohio Department of Health
SUPPORT STATEWIDE OVERDOSE DETECTION MAPPING APPLICATION PROGRAM
Columbus, OH$533K2022
Portsmouth County
PREVENTING AND REDUCING OVERDOSE DEATHS ASSOCIATED WITH OPIOIDS
Portsmouth, OH$531K2023
Advocates for Human Potential
PREPARE THE GUIDELINES FOR MANAGING SUBSTANCE WITHDRAWAL IN JAILS FOR BJA
Sudbury, MA$521K2024
University of Baltimore
DEVELOPMENT OF AN OVERDOSE DETECTION AND MAPPING APPLICATION PROGRAM (ODMAP)
Baltimore, MD$494K2022
Eastern Bank of Cherokee Indians
PREVENTION AND INTERVENTION ACTIVITIES TO REDUCE OVERDOSE DEATHS AND FACILITATE ACCESS TO TREATMENT AND RECOVERY
Cherokee, NC$474K2023
Porter-starke Services Inc
PREVENTING AND REDUCING OVERDOSE DEATHS ASSOCIATED WITH OPIOIDS
Valparaiso, IN$422K2022
The National Center for the Prevention of Community Violence
SUPPORT A PROOF OF CONCEPT FOR AN ALREADY DEVELOPED HEALTH AND WELLNESS MOBILE APPLICATION FOR LAW ENFORCEMENT
Hampton, VA$388K2022
Marcum and Wallace Memorial Hospital Inc
PREVENTING AND REDUCING OVERDOSE DEATHS ASSOCIATED WITH OPIOIDS
Irvine, KY$357K2023
White Earth Behavioral Health Division
PREVENTION AND INTERVENTION ACTIVITIES TO REDUCE OVERDOSE DEATHS AND FACILITATE ACCESS TO TREATMENT AND RECOVERY
Ogema, MN$348K2022
Memorial Regional Health
PREVENTING AND REDUCING OVERDOSE DEATHS ASSOCIATED WITH OPIOIDS
Craig, CO$345K2022
